The first thing to check is the age and condition of your fuel pump relay. Like most car parts, fuel pump relays aren’t immortal. According to automotive experts, their average lifespan ranges between 50,000 to 100,000 miles. If your vehicle has clocked over 60,000 miles and you’ve never swapped out the relay, odds are it’s pretty worn out. I remember reading a case study where a guy had a 2008 Honda Accord. His relay gave out completely around 75,000 miles. He replaced it; no more issues. Simple, right?

Corrosion and dirt can also cause intermittent relay engagement. If your relay box has been exposed to moisture or dirt, that could be your problem. When I had my old Ford F-150, I found rust on the relay terminals. A little bit of cleaning with contact cleaner, and boom, it was functioning like new. Electrical issues, such as a weak battery, can be another major contributor. If your vehicle’s battery isn’t providing a steady 12 volts, your relay won’t engage properly. One time my friend Bob was driving his 2012 Toyota Camry, and he was always complaining about the relay acting up. Turns out, his battery voltage was down to 10.5 volts. Changed the battery; problem solved. Always use a multimeter to check your battery’s voltage to make sure it’s within the optimal range.
Speaking of voltage, don’t forget to inspect related fuses. Fuses are safety devices, and when they blow, they can disrupt the circuit feeding your relay. I’ve come across a report where a 2010 Nissan Altima had blown a fuse, causing the relay to fail. Changing a $1 fuse saved them a trip to the mechanic. It might also be worthwhile checking the wires connected to your relay. A broken or frayed wire disrupts the current flow, causing the relay to disengage. I stumbled onto a blog post where a guy was dealing with a similar issue in his 2015 Subaru Outback. He had a broken wire leading to the fuel pump relay. Replaced the wire, and everything was golden. Strong wiring connections are critical for any electrical system in a car.
If you’re technically inclined, you might consider using a relay tester. This tool helps diagnose if the relay is failing under load. When I first heard about relay testers, I thought they were only for professionals. But no, they’re quite accessible. It costs around $30 and can save you a lot of headaches. I remember testing my relay and finding out it was functional until it got a certain load, then it would fail. Replacing it was a no-brainer.
Lastly, modern vehicles have intricate computerized systems managing parts like the fuel pump relay. An ECU (Engine Control Unit) software glitch can cause the relay to act up. Recall the 2017 Chevy Impala incident? Owners reported software issues leading to relay engagement failures. Updating the car’s software at the dealership solved it. It’s a more complex issue, but sometimes a simple software update can fix it.
